Police Quest games are an obvious example if you're into point and click adventures.
Hill Streets Blues for the Amiga was a fun and pretty ambitious game.
SWAT 3 and 4 are obvious choices. There's also SWAT 2, though I remember it was pretty clunky. Rainbow Six games are, sorta, similar, and Doorkickers tries to emulate the strategic mission planning R6.
L.A. Noire may also scratch the itch.
Emergency is sorta a cop game too? It's an RTS where you command various rescue services like ambulances, firefighters and cops.
The problem with many police games is that while the protagonist is a cop, the games rarely focus on making the player immerse themselves into the role of a cop.
Honorable mentions go to Urban Chaos: Riot Response for letting you be a riot cop and Beat Cop for the interesting concept.
